Why is UK's market share falling?
Britain has been selling more than ever before in Hong Kong, although it represents only about 3% of Hong Kong's total imports.
Almost all the other major suppliers have lost market share because China has become an increasingly important source of imports and a manufacturing base for Hong Kong companies.
